Summary: Provide funds for Special Olympics Alaska to purchase new Team Polo uniforms for the Anchorage Community Program.


It has been nearly ten years since the Special Olympics program was able to overhaul their

Team Polo. The new uniforms will ensure that all participants have a cohesive, professional appearance, promoting team unity and community pride. The funds will cover the cost of high-quality, durable Polo shirts featuring the program's logo, in various sizes to accommodate all participants. Approximately 200 individuals will benefit from the new uniforms.

The mission of the Unified Champion Schools program, in more than 80 schools across the state, goes beyond athletics to foster inclusion, build friendships, and enhance life skills through school programs, health initiatives, and community engagement. The program's commitment to health & well-being is reflected in its year-round fitness programs and essential health screenings, which provide vision, hearing, dental, podiatry, general physical exams, and social-emotional wellness checks for Alaskans with disabilities.

The grant will provide approximately one-third of the total cost of the new Team Polo uniforms. The Anchorage Community Program has allocated reserves to cover the remaining two-thirds of the cost.

The funds will be distributed to Special Olympics Alaska as soon as the matching grant funds are received, hopefully by the start of the 2025-2026 school year.

AER will participate in the distribution of the new Team Polos, and in community sports and outreach events when & where possible throughout the year.
